Home
last modified time | relevance | path

Searched refs:TK_EQEQ (Results 1 – 10 of 10) sorted by relevance

/external/skia/src/sksl/
DSkSLConstantFolder.cpp39 (op.kind() == Token::Kind::TK_EQEQ && rightVal) || // (expr == true) -> (expr) in eliminate_no_op_boolean()
80 if (op.kind() == Token::Kind::TK_EQEQ || op.kind() == Token::Kind::TK_NEQ) { in simplify_vector()
81 bool equality = (op.kind() == Token::Kind::TK_EQEQ); in simplify_vector()
360 case Token::Kind::TK_EQEQ: result = leftVal == rightVal; break; in Simplify()
384 if (op.kind() == Token::Kind::TK_EQEQ && Analysis::IsSameExpressionTree(*left, *right)) { in Simplify()
446 case Token::Kind::TK_EQEQ: return RESULT(Bool, ==); in Simplify()
481 case Token::Kind::TK_EQEQ: return RESULT(Bool, ==); in Simplify()
533 case Token::Kind::TK_EQEQ: in Simplify()
DSkSLOperators.cpp29 case Kind::TK_EQEQ: // fall through in getBinaryPrecedence()
71 case Kind::TK_EQEQ: in isOperator()
114 case Kind::TK_EQEQ: return "=="; in operatorName()
261 case Token::Kind::TK_EQEQ: // left == right in determineBinaryType()
DSkSLLexer.h83 TK_EQEQ, enumerator
DSkSLAnalysis.cpp872 case Token::Kind::TK_EQEQ: in invalid_for_ES2()
958 case Token::Kind::TK_EQEQ: return val == loopEnd; in invalid_for_ES2()
DSkSLParser.cpp1771 case Token::Kind::TK_EQEQ: // fall through in equalityExpression()
/external/skia/src/sksl/ir/
DSkSLTernaryExpression.cpp29 Operator equalityOp(Token::Kind::TK_EQEQ); in Convert()
/external/skia/src/sksl/dsl/
DDSLExpression.cpp206 OP(==, TK_EQEQ)
/external/skia/src/sksl/codegen/
DSkSLSPIRVCodeGenerator.cpp2402 case Token::Kind::TK_EQEQ: { in writeBinaryExpression()
2531 SkASSERT(op.kind() == Token::Kind::TK_EQEQ || op.kind() == Token::Kind::TK_NEQ); in writeArrayComparison()
2559 SkASSERT(op.kind() == Token::Kind::TK_EQEQ || op.kind() == Token::Kind::TK_NEQ); in writeStructComparison()
2596 case Token::Kind::TK_EQEQ: in mergeComparisons()
DSkSLMetalCodeGenerator.cpp1352 case Token::Kind::TK_EQEQ: in writeBinaryExpression()
DSkSLVMCodeGenerator.cpp569 case Token::Kind::TK_EQEQ: { in writeBinaryExpression()